My thoughts on the Atomstack Kraft

I’ve used several laser engravers and cutters over the years, but the AtomStack Kraft Dual Laser Cutter is easily one of the most versatile machines I’ve worked with. It combines powerful cutting, precise engraving, and excellent expandability in a single professional-grade tool.

One of its standout features is the dual-laser system, which includes a 20W blue diode laser and a 1.2W infrared (IR) laser. This allows the Kraft to handle a huge range of materials without swapping modules. The blue diode laser is excellent for cutting and engraving materials like wood, leather, acrylic, bamboo, paper, fabrics, and more. The infrared laser is ideal for engraving metals such as stainless steel, gold, silver, brass, and aluminum with impressive precision. You can even use both lasers together for deeper cuts and sharper engraving, which increases efficiency compared to single-laser machines.

The machine handles a wide variety of materials including wood, plywood, MDF, bamboo, leather, denim, acrylic, plastics, paper, cardboard, fabric, felt, stone, slate, coated metals, and stainless steel. With the power of the diode laser, it can cut wood up to around 10 mm thick and acrylic in a single pass depending on the material. For crafts, prototyping, and small-scale manufacturing, this versatility is extremely valuable.

The 50 × 32 cm working area provides plenty of room for larger projects or batch production. The included honeycomb bed improves airflow under materials, helping reduce burn marks and producing cleaner cuts, which is especially noticeable with thin wood, paper, or fabrics.

The machine can also be expanded with accessories. The AtomStack R7 Pro Conveyor Feeder can extend the work area to roughly 80 × 50 cm, allowing processing of long materials or continuous sheets. While I haven’t personally used it yet, my girlfriend has found it very useful for cutting fabric patterns, working with long boards, making signs, and producing repeated parts.

Engraving quality is excellent thanks to the small laser spot size and precise motion system, allowing detailed graphics, text, and patterns on many materials. With the AtomStack R8 Rotary Chuck, the machine can engrave cylindrical or irregular objects like tumblers, bottles, rings, and other curved items. Combined with the dual-laser setup, this allows engraving on wood, acrylic, leather, fabric, stone, plastics, and metals including stainless steel, gold, silver, and aluminum.

The Kraft also includes several user-friendly features such as a built-in 16 MP camera for positioning, one-touch autofocus, batch engraving, speeds up to 600 mm/s, and power-loss resume. It works with software like LightBurn, LaserGRBL, and AtomStack Studio, though taking time to properly calibrate the camera is important.

One of my favorite uses for the Kraft is creating precision parts for hobby and model-building projects. It makes it easy to produce miniature furniture kits, RC airplane parts, model boats, architectural models, mechanical kits, and custom craft projects. Because it supports multiple materials and thicknesses, you can design and manufacture complete kits using wood, plastic, fabric, leather, and more.

Overall, the AtomStack Kraft is an extremely capable and versatile laser cutter and engraver. With its dual-laser system, wide material compatibility, expandable workspace, rotary engraving support, and professional-level precision, it’s a powerful tool for makers, hobbyists, and small workshops. Whether you're engraving metal jewelry, cutting intricate wood parts, producing crafts, or creating detailed models, the Kraft handles it all with impressive ease.

I sincerely recommended it for anyone serious about laser cutting and engraving.

I’m satisfied with my Atomstack…

I’m satisfied with my Atomstack Hurricane. The machine is powerful, reliable, and delivers consistently high-quality results. Setup was straightforward, performance exceeds expectations, and it has quickly become an essential part of my workflow. Highly recommended!
